What is the theoretical yield, in g, of ethanamide, \( CH_{3}CONH_{2} \), that can be produced from the reaction of 4.00 g of ammonium carbonate, \( (NH_{4})_{2}CO_{3} \), with excess ethanoic acid, \( CH_{3}COOH \)?
\( CH_{3}COOH(l)+(NH_{4})_{2}CO_{3}(s)\rightarrow 2CH_{3}COONH_{4}(aq)+H_{2}O(l)+CO_{2}(g) \)
\( CH_{3}COONH_{4}(aq)\rightarrow CH_{3}CONH_{2}(s)+H_{2}O(l) \)
\( M_{r}(NH_{4})_{2}CO_{3}=96.11 \)
\( M_{r}CH_{3}CONH_{2}=59.08 \)
